Mango Communications rebrands to FleishmanHillard Aotearoa
One of New Zealand’s largest and most awarded public relations agencies has today unveiled a new name as part of Omnicom Oceania’s evolving communications offering.
Mango Communications Aotearoa will now operate as FleishmanHillard Aotearoa, becoming part of the globally recognised and highly-regarded FleishmanHillard network.
Sean Brown, Managing Director of FleishmanHillard Aotearoa, says the move represents much more than a name change: “This is a significant step for our team and our clients. This move connects us to a powerful global network and strengthens our trans-Tasman collaboration. We now have access to more than 250 specialists in PR, social, creators and activations across ANZ, as well as advanced global tools, insights and expertise from the FleishmanHillard network.”
FleishmanHillard Aotearoa will continue to be co-located with McCann Group NZ (formerly DDB Group Aotearoa & FCB Aotearoa). As part of Omnicom’s Earned centre of excellence, the rebrand will also enable deeper collaboration across all Omnicom Oceania agencies.
Brown says the new structure will allow the team to expand the breadth of services it offers clients: “We already offer full-service earned creative, corporate communications, influencer and social capabilities, as well as experiential and event production. Through FleishmanHillard, we now have even greater access to global expertise, specialist services and integrated communications capabilities.”
The agency will continue to deliver earned creative and strategic communications for its diverse client portfolio, which includes McDonald’s, Samsung, New Balance, AMEX and Booking.com alongside other leading local and global brands.
While the transition marks an important new chapter, Brown acknowledges the legacy of Mango Communications in New Zealand: “There are so many positives to this change, but it is also somewhat bittersweet. Mango has been a leading agency in New Zealand for more than 20 years. It’s a brand that’s been widely recognised by clients and industry talent alike, and it has produced countless award-winning campaigns for both local and global brands.”
Omnicom Oceania’s government relations and strategic communications firm, GRC Partners, will also be co-located alongside FleishmanHillard, providing clients with deep insights and expertise, set against the backdrop of a general election year. GRC Partners is the local arm of GRACosway, with offices across Australasia, including Auckland and Wellington.
Roberto Pace, CEO of Earned, Omnicom Oceania says the rebrand positions FleishmanHillard to further strengthen its leadership in the New Zealand market: “There are significant opportunities ahead for FleishmanHillard in New Zealand. Sean and the team have built a reputation for delivering best-in-class earned creative, strategy and execution for leading brands, and being part of the global FleishmanHillard network will only strengthen that offering.”
The rebrand takes effect immediately.
